Output ef3f470e2a3ba74e9810c359ce13d7291f8c6103e04fde51abd75040232e6626:1

value
1928539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c85e70ae9beabec7c4828383b8b2ff01b00958aa OP_EQUAL
address
MSAcWcZVtDqLv4CDjfphseFbH2U3WgJzK5
transaction
ef3f470e2a3ba74e9810c359ce13d7291f8c6103e04fde51abd75040232e6626
spent
true